#16 Mark Johnson: Master Somm Exams to Cold-Pressed Juice, a Life Reimagined
from Serves You Right · host Andrew Roy
In this powerful and unfiltered conversation, I sit down with Mark Johnson: a hospitality veteran, sommelier, educator, and now national sales director for a cold-pressed juice company.Mark’s journey is a masterclass in transformation. From a music student waiting tables to managing top restaurants in Nashville and Santa Fe, studying under legends like Doug Frost, and mentoring future wine professionals.
